Spray foam insulation by area: Hamden vs Hartford

Spray foam is priced by board foot (1 sq ft at 1 inch thick), which works out to about $1.50–$5 per sq ft of surface installed depending on foam type and thickness. Closed-cell costs more but adds twice the R-value per inch.

Best time to buy

Cheapest time for spray foam insulation in either city

Everyone waits until fall to insulate, which is exactly why fall costs the most. Spring and summer are quieter for installers and often catch a fresh year's rebate budget before it runs dry.

Editors' roundtable

How much insulation is worth paying for?

R-value, air-sealing and material decide both the price and the payback. Our editors on the trade-offs.

The R-value case

Insulate to the DOE recommendation for your climate zone — under-insulating to save money leaves comfort and energy savings on the table that would have paid the job back.

The air-sealing case

Insulation without air-sealing underperforms. Sealing leaks first is cheap and often delivers more comfort per dollar than thicker insulation alone — make sure it's in the scope.

The rebate case

Insulation has some of the best rebate math in home improvement — utility and state programs can cover a solid share (the federal 25C credits ended Dec 2025). Check DSIRE before you book and time it to a fresh rebate budget.

Our take

Of every home upgrade, insulation rewards doing it right the most: air-seal first, meet the DOE R-value for your climate zone, and use the rebates on the table. Cutting the scope here just delays the payback.
